How to Stop Specific Errors from reporting on 2003 and 2008


Recommended Posts

What is this error your wanting to stop? Normally without fixing the issue its not possible to stop logging of an error.

What you could do is filter what the admin is looking at - if there is a specific error that is "noise" for now - then just view the log through a filter where that error is not displayed.

Even if you consider the information useless it is good to have it logged, i suppose the only concern is how often you are seeing this message, if it's 100's a day then you may have to increase your log file size to ensure legitimate error's and other logging is not knocked off the end of the log by your 100's of meaningless ones. (im assuming you are setup for circular logging).

    • Yeah, this is absolutely nothing new and EA have done it before. Burnout Paradise, released in 2008, had dynamic advertising billboards that were updated via the internet and targeted people based on location and what EA knew about them from their profile. It was particularly notable for the fact that the Obama presidential campaign ran ads in the game, in an attempt to reach a younger audience who didn't watch broadcast TV any more. It was by no means the first though. Battlefield 2142 from 2006 had the same thing. In fact, Neowin wrote a story about it back then. https://www.neowin.net/news/ba...-in-game-ads-clarification/
